MeVisLab 1.5 Final Release

MeVis Research is proud to announce the MeVisLab 1.5 Final Release, which adds support for Mac OS X as well as Microsoft VC 2003 and 2005 development platforms.

The final release of the MeVisLab 1.5 SDK is now available for three Microsoft compilers, Mac OS X, and Linux.

The final release has been support by several MeVisLab users who gave valuable feedback to the 1.5 Release Candidate made available a few weeks ago. Thanks to all of you!

The highlights of the 1.5 release are:

  • Brand new Mac OS X version
  • Support for Microsoft .Net 2003 and Visual Studio 2005
  • New Contour Segmentation Object (CSO) library
  • New SoShader framework providing a framework to use the OpenGL Shading Language (GLSL) in MeVisLab networks
  • ITK/VTK integration updated to latest library versions
  • New ITKVTKGenerator tool for integrating your own ITK/VTK modules into MeVisLab
  • Major library update (Qt4, SoQtMeVis, thirdparty libraries)
  • Many new and improved modules

We decided to only release one big SDK installer instead of various AddOns.
The MeVisLab SDK now contains:

  • MeVisLab Standard Modules
  • MeVisLab Module SDK
  • ITK/VTK Modules (which used to be two separate AddOns)
  • ITK/VTK SDK
  • Open Inventor SDK (which used to be a separate installer)
